La conversion de XLS à ODT expliquée
Convertir un fichier .XLS en .ODT transforme un ancien tableur binaire en un document de traitement de texte à standard ouvert. On effectue cette conversion pour extraire des données tabulaires d'anciens fichiers Microsoft Excel et les placer dans un rapport textuel paginé.
Quand tu convertis un .XLS en .ODT, tu obtiens une mise en page imprimable et une lisibilité à long terme grâce à un standard ouvert. Cependant, tu perds toutes les fonctionnalités du tableur. Les formules, les macros VBA, les tableaux croisés dynamiques et les références de cellules dynamiques sont définitivement détruits. Les données deviennent du texte statique organisé dans des tableaux de document.
Si tu as besoin de conserver tes calculs, tes capacités de tri ou tes graphiques dynamiques, cette conversion est une mauvaise idée. Tu devrais plutôt convertir en .ODS (OpenDocument Spreadsheet) ou en .XLSX. Ne convertis en .ODT que lorsque les données de ton tableur doivent être intégrées à un document écrit.
Tâches et utilisateurs typiques
Cette conversion inter-domaines est courante pour les utilisateurs qui déplacent des données d'outils analytiques vers des formats de publication.
- Chercheurs et analystes : Extraire des tableaux de données statiques d'anciens jeux de données .XLS pour les inclure dans des articles universitaires ou des rapports techniques publiés.
- Archivistes : Convertir d'anciens tableurs binaires non pris en charge vers un format texte standardisé pour un stockage à long terme en lecture seule.
- Comptables et agents financiers : Transformer des données de facturation calculées ou des bilans en documents statiques et paginés pour les envoyer aux clients ou pour des dépôts légaux.
Logiciels et outils compatibles
Plusieurs outils peuvent ouvrir les anciens fichiers .XLS et exporter les données en .ODT.
- LibreOffice : La suite gratuite et open-source LibreOffice gère cela nativement. Tu peux ouvrir un .XLS dans Calc, copier les données et les coller dans Writer pour les enregistrer en .ODT.
- Apache OpenOffice : Similaire à LibreOffice, cette suite gratuite offre une excellente prise en charge des anciens formats binaires de Microsoft.
- Microsoft Office : Microsoft Excel peut ouvrir les fichiers .XLS. Tu peux déplacer les données vers Microsoft Word, qui permet de les enregistrer directement au format .ODT.
- Ligne de commande et code : Les développeurs peuvent utiliser des bibliothèques Python comme pandas pour analyser les données binaires .XLS, puis utiliser odfpy pour écrire ces données de manière programmatique dans un document texte .ODT. Pandoc peut aussi être utilisé si le tableur est d'abord exporté en CSV ou en Markdown.
Avantages et inconvénients de la conversion
Avantages :
- Standardisation ouverte : Le .ODT est un standard OASIS basé sur XML. Il garantit une lisibilité à long terme sans dépendre d'un logiciel propriétaire de Microsoft.
- Pagination : Il force une grille de tableur infinie dans une mise en page stricte et imprimable (comme A4 ou Lettre US).
- Intégration de texte : Le .ODT te permet d'entourer facilement tes tableaux de données avec des paragraphes explicatifs, des en-têtes et des notes de bas de page.
Inconvénients :
- Perte totale de logique : La conversion supprime toutes les formules mathématiques. Une cellule contenant
=SUM(A1:A10) devient un nombre en texte statique. - Troncation de la mise en page : Les tableurs sont souvent plus larges qu'une page de document standard. Les lignes .XLS trop larges vont se casser, se chevaucher ou être coupées aux marges de la page .ODT.
- Suppression de fonctionnalités : Les macros, la mise en forme conditionnelle, les règles de validation des données et les volets figés n'existent pas dans les formats de traitement de texte et seront ignorés.
Difficultés de conversion et pourquoi choisir Convert.Guru
Convertir un tableur en document texte est techniquement difficile car les structures de données sont complètement différentes. Le processus de conversion doit analyser le format propriétaire Compound File Binary Format (CFBF) du fichier .XLS. Il doit extraire les valeurs brutes et le formatage des cellules, puis les mapper vers les structures de tableau XML OpenDocument (<table:table>).
Le plus gros point de défaillance est le mappage de la largeur des colonnes. Une grille de tableur n'a pas de limites de page physiques, alors qu'un fichier .ODT impose des marges strictes. Les mauvais convertisseurs généreront des fichiers .ODT où les tableaux débordent du bord de la page, rendant les données illisibles. De plus, les anciennes polices binaires et les bordures de cellules se traduisent souvent mal vers le style XML.
Convert.Guru est un excellent choix pour ce processus car il gère la traduction binaire vers XML avec précision. Il mappe intelligemment les colonnes du tableur vers les tableaux du document et applique une mise à l'échelle optimale pour éviter le débordement des marges. Il supprime en toute sécurité les macros et les formules non prises en charge sans corrompre le texte final, garantissant que tes données restent intactes et lisibles.
XLS vs ODT : Quel est le meilleur choix ?
| Caractéristique | .XLS (Binaire Excel) | .ODT (Texte OpenDocument) |
| Utilisation principale | Calcul et analyse de données | Traitement de texte et création de rapports |
| Structure des données | Grille infinie de cellules | Texte paginé et tableaux statiques |
| Formules et macros | Entièrement prises en charge (VBA) | Non prises en charge |
| Format sous-jacent | Binaire propriétaire (BIFF8) | Open XML dans une archive ZIP |
| Mise en page | Fluide, les zones d'impression doivent être définies | Stricte, définie par la taille de la page et les marges |
Quel format devrais-tu choisir ?
Choisis le .XLS (ou passe de préférence au format moderne .XLSX) si tu as besoin de calculer des nombres, de trier de grands jeux de données, d'utiliser des formules ou de créer des graphiques dynamiques. Les tableurs sont conçus pour la manipulation de données.
Choisis le .ODT si tu rédiges un rapport contenant beaucoup de texte, si tu as besoin d'une pagination stricte et si tu ne requiers que des tableaux statiques pour la lecture.
Quand éviter cette conversion : Ne convertis pas un .XLS en .ODT si tu veux simplement un tableur open-source. Si ton but est de t'éloigner de Microsoft Excel mais de garder tes formules et ta disposition en grille, tu devrais plutôt convertir ton .XLS en .ODS (OpenDocument Spreadsheet).
Conclusion
Convertir un .XLS en .ODT n'a de sens que lorsque tu as besoin d'extraire des données tabulaires d'un ancien tableur et de les intégrer dans un document texte standardisé et paginé. La plus grande limite à surveiller est la perte absolue des formules mathématiques et le risque que des tableaux trop larges cassent ta mise en page. Convert.Guru est un choix fiable pour cette conversion précise car il traduit proprement les données du tableur binaire en tableaux XML correctement mis à l'échelle, garantissant que tes anciennes données sont préservées dans un format lisible et prêt à être imprimé.
À propos du convertisseur XLS vers ODT
Convert.Guru permet de convertir rapidement et facilement des anciennes feuilles de calcul Excel en ODT en ligne. Le convertisseur XLS vers ODT fonctionne entièrement dans votre navigateur, il n'y a donc aucun logiciel à installer et aucun compte n'est requis. Propulsée par l'une des bases de données de formats de fichiers les plus vastes et les plus fiables du secteur — maintenue depuis plus de 25 ans — notre technologie identifie de manière fiable les feuilles de calcul XLS, même lorsqu'ils sont endommagés ou mal nommés. Les fichiers téléchargés sont automatiquement supprimés après la conversion pour protéger votre vie privée.